re PR ada/42153 (s-osinte.adb:46:21: missing body for "To_Duration" declared at s...
authorEric Botcazou <ebotcazou@adacore.com>
Mon, 23 Nov 2009 14:56:58 +0000 (14:56 +0000)
committerLaurent Guerby <guerby@gcc.gnu.org>
Mon, 23 Nov 2009 14:56:58 +0000 (14:56 +0000)
commita7194bfea995c4bfc8f01ce18e36ef8bda7ebe16
tree95a5c8e808a83305f6684ff799d355fecbaf01f8
parentaa373032bfd895dc6eb671308b68163f2971ffd2
re PR ada/42153 (s-osinte.adb:46:21: missing body for "To_Duration" declared at s-osinte.ads:216)

2009-11-23  Eric Botcazou  <ebotcazou@adacore.com>
            Laurent GUERBY  <laurent@guerby.net>

PR ada/42153
        * s-osinte-linux.ads (struct_timeval): Delete.
        * s-osinte-hpux.ads (struct_timeval, To_Duration, To_Timeval):
        Delete.
        * s-osinte-kfreebsd-gnu.ads: Likewise.
        * s-osinte-rtems.ads: Likewise.
        * s-osinte-aix.ads: Likewise.
        * s-osinte-hpux-dce.ads: Likewise.
        * s-osinte-darwin.ads: Likewise.
        * s-osinte-solaris-posix.ads: Likewise.
        * s-osinte-irix.ads: Likewise.
        * s-osinte-solaris.ads: Likewise.
        * s-osinte-hpux-dce.adb (To_Duration, To_Timeval): Delete.
        * s-osinte-irix.adb: Likewise.
        * s-osinte-solaris.adb: Likewise.
        * s-osinte-rtems.adb: Likewise. Minor reformatting.
        * s-osinte-aix.adb (To_Duration, To_Timeval): Delete.
        (clock_gettime): Use cal.c timeval_to_duration.
        * s-osinte-darwin.adb: Likewise.

Co-Authored-By: Laurent GUERBY <laurent@guerby.net>
From-SVN: r154446
17 files changed:
gcc/ada/ChangeLog
gcc/ada/s-osinte-aix.adb
gcc/ada/s-osinte-aix.ads
gcc/ada/s-osinte-darwin.adb
gcc/ada/s-osinte-darwin.ads
gcc/ada/s-osinte-hpux-dce.adb
gcc/ada/s-osinte-hpux-dce.ads
gcc/ada/s-osinte-hpux.ads
gcc/ada/s-osinte-irix.adb
gcc/ada/s-osinte-irix.ads
gcc/ada/s-osinte-kfreebsd-gnu.ads
gcc/ada/s-osinte-linux.ads
gcc/ada/s-osinte-rtems.adb
gcc/ada/s-osinte-rtems.ads
gcc/ada/s-osinte-solaris-posix.ads
gcc/ada/s-osinte-solaris.adb
gcc/ada/s-osinte-solaris.ads